Officers have today (15 May) conducted a Misuse of Drugs Act warrant at a property in Workington.  

The warrant was carried out at a property on Blackburn Street, where officers recovered drugs and arrested four people.

  • A 37-year-old woman from Silloth was arrested on suspicion of being concerned in the supply of a class A drug.
  • A 43-year-old man from Silloth was arrested on suspicion of being concerned in the supply of a class A drug.
  • A 40-year-old man from no fixed address was arrested on suspicion of being concerned in the supply of a class A drug.
  • A 45-year-old man from Workington was arrested on suspicion of supplying a controlled drug of a class A.

All four remain in police custody.
